草庐IT

where-clause

全部标签

c# - 通用约束,其中 T : struct and where T : class

我想区分以下情况:普通值类型(例如int)可空值类型(例如int?)引用类型(例如string)-可选,我不关心它是否映射到上面的(1)或(2)我想出了以下代码,它适用于情况(1)和(2):staticvoidFoo(Ta)whereT:struct{}//1staticvoidFoo(T?a)whereT:struct{}//2但是,如果我尝试像这样检测案例(3),它不会编译:staticvoidFoo(Ta)whereT:class{}//3错误消息是类型“X”已经用相同的参数类型定义了一个名为“Foo”的成员。好吧,不知何故,我无法区分whereT:struct和whereT:c

c# - LINQ 中的动态 WHERE 子句

将动态WHERE子句组装到LINQ语句的最佳方法是什么?我在表单上有几十个复选框,并将它们作为:Dictionary>(Dictionary>)传回我的LINQ查询。publicIOrderedQueryableGetProductList(stringproductGroupName,stringproductTypeName,Dictionary>filterDictionary){varq=fromcindb.ProductDetailwherec.ProductGroupName==productGroupName&&c.ProductTypeName==productType

c# - LINQ 中的动态 WHERE 子句

将动态WHERE子句组装到LINQ语句的最佳方法是什么?我在表单上有几十个复选框,并将它们作为:Dictionary>(Dictionary>)传回我的LINQ查询。publicIOrderedQueryableGetProductList(stringproductGroupName,stringproductTypeName,Dictionary>filterDictionary){varq=fromcindb.ProductDetailwherec.ProductGroupName==productGroupName&&c.ProductTypeName==productType

c# - WPF/C# : Where should I be saving user preferences files?

保存用户首选项文件的推荐位置是什么?是否有推荐的处理用户偏好的方法?目前我使用从typeof(MyLibrary).Assembly.Location返回的路径作为默认位置来存储应用程序生成或需要的文件。编辑:我发现了两个相关/有趣的问题:BestplacetosaveuserinformationforWindowsXPandVistaapplicationsWhat'sthewaytoimplementSave/Loadfunctionality?编辑#2:这只是对像我这样以前从未使用过设置的人的说明。设置非常有用,但我必须进行大量挖掘才能弄清楚发生了什么(来自Python世界,而

c# - WPF/C# : Where should I be saving user preferences files?

保存用户首选项文件的推荐位置是什么?是否有推荐的处理用户偏好的方法?目前我使用从typeof(MyLibrary).Assembly.Location返回的路径作为默认位置来存储应用程序生成或需要的文件。编辑:我发现了两个相关/有趣的问题:BestplacetosaveuserinformationforWindowsXPandVistaapplicationsWhat'sthewaytoimplementSave/Loadfunctionality?编辑#2:这只是对像我这样以前从未使用过设置的人的说明。设置非常有用,但我必须进行大量挖掘才能弄清楚发生了什么(来自Python世界,而

c# - 具有 LINQ 扩展方法的多个 WHERE 子句

我有一个如下所示的LINQ查询:DateTimetoday=DateTime.UtcNow;varresults=fromorderincontext.Orderswhere((order.OrderDate我正在努力学习/理解LINQ。在某些情况下,我需要添加两个额外的WHERE子句。为了做到这一点,我正在使用:if(useAdditionalClauses){results=results.Where(o=>o.OrderStatus==OrderStatus.Open)//NowI'mstuck.}如您所见,我知道如何添加一个额外的WHERE子句。但是我如何添加多个?例如,我想添

c# - 具有 LINQ 扩展方法的多个 WHERE 子句

我有一个如下所示的LINQ查询:DateTimetoday=DateTime.UtcNow;varresults=fromorderincontext.Orderswhere((order.OrderDate我正在努力学习/理解LINQ。在某些情况下,我需要添加两个额外的WHERE子句。为了做到这一点,我正在使用:if(useAdditionalClauses){results=results.Where(o=>o.OrderStatus==OrderStatus.Open)//NowI'mstuck.}如您所见,我知道如何添加一个额外的WHERE子句。但是我如何添加多个?例如,我想添

c# - LINQ to SQL Where 子句可选条件

我正在使用LINQtoSQL查询并遇到一个问题,我有4个可选字段来过滤数据结果。可选的,我的意思是可以选择是否输入值。具体来说,一些文本框可能有一个值或一个空字符串,还有一些下拉列表可能已经选择了一个值,也可能没有...例如:using(TagsModelDataContextdb=newTagsModelDataContext()){varquery=fromtagsindb.TagsHeaderswheretags.CST.Equals(this.SelectedCust.CustCode.ToUpper())&&Utility.GetDate(DateTime.Parse(thi

c# - LINQ to SQL Where 子句可选条件

我正在使用LINQtoSQL查询并遇到一个问题,我有4个可选字段来过滤数据结果。可选的,我的意思是可以选择是否输入值。具体来说,一些文本框可能有一个值或一个空字符串,还有一些下拉列表可能已经选择了一个值,也可能没有...例如:using(TagsModelDataContextdb=newTagsModelDataContext()){varquery=fromtagsindb.TagsHeaderswheretags.CST.Equals(this.SelectedCust.CustCode.ToUpper())&&Utility.GetDate(DateTime.Parse(thi

java.sql.SQLSyntaxErrorException问题常见解决方案:比如Table xxx doesn‘t exist;Unknown column ‘xxx‘ in ‘where...

文章目录1.Table'jqp.spring_session'doesn'texist1.1分析问题1.2解决问题1.2.1第一种解决方法1.2.2第二种解决方式2.Tablexdoesn'texist3.YouhaveanerrorinyourSQLsyntax;4.Unknowncolumnxinx5.Unknowncolumn'xxx'in'whereclause'1.Table‘jqp.spring_session’doesn’texist我们有时在启动本地项目,或者启动git上下载的源码时,会报错如下错误:org.springframework.jdbc.BadSqlGrammarE